For Stars had me hooked with their amazing debut album and I have been highly anticipating Windows For Stars. Did they disappoint? Not one bit. They surpassed all expectations easily. What should you expect? Well, the best way to put it is emotional almost none moving pop that is sung with a breathy falsetto at most and experimental instrumentation backing singer, Carlos Forster. Very much influenced by the bands of Dean Warham the band just works on that sound until the beauty or sadness (whichever emotion is touched) just oozes out into your every pore. This is a great disc to throw on in the later part of the evening to wind down to. This San Francisco group has a great future with their inventive way of poising the pop metaphor.
